2022年软考软件设计师历年案例分析真题详析视频课程
19599 人在学
2020下半年软件设计师考试已经结束,今天课课家小编为大家整理了2020年软件设计师下午真题(四),供考生参考。
【说明】
希尔排序算法又称最小增量排序算法,其基本思想是:
步骤1 :构造一个步长序列delta、deltak、 deltak ,其中delta1=n/2 ,后面的每个delta是前一个的1/2 , deltak=1;
步骤2 :根据步长序列、进行k趟排序;
步骤3 :对第i趟排序,根据对应的步长delta,将等步长位置元素分组,对同一组内元素在原位置上进行直接插入排序。
[问题1]根据说明和c代码,填充c代码中的空(1) ~ (4)。
[问题2]根据说明和c代码,该算法的时间复杂度(5)0(n2) (小于、等于或大于)。该算法是否稳定(6)(是或否)。
[问题3]对数组(15、9、7、8、20、-1、 4)用希尔排序方法进行排序,经过di-趟排后得到的数组为(7)。
课课家教育专注软考培训10年以上,一直坚持自主研发,将丰富的软考培训经验有效融入教程研发过程,自成体系的软考视频教程、软考培训教材和软考在线题库,使考生的学习更具系统性,辅导更具针对性。想要报考2020年软考的考生现在就可以开始备考了,报名课课家软考各科目考试赠送:辅导教材、历年真题、考前冲剌资料、在线模拟测试题库、老师专属答疑指导等,以保障学员顺利通过考试。
>>>>>>点击进入软考报名专题
相关推荐:2020年软件设计师下午真题及答案解析
共65节 · 5小时32分钟套餐优惠
¥199.0019599人在学
共89节 · 8小时14分钟套餐优惠
¥199.0023779人在学
共71节 · 26小时53分钟套餐优惠
¥299.0039331人在学
共26节 · 4小时21分钟套餐优惠
¥199.0020236人在学